Themes Naturales quaestiones




contemplation of nature seneca unchains mind (quote bjornlie of corcoran translation) enabling person transcend evil, , experiencing totum of nature, develop consciousness , being more compatible direct experience of god, elevating 1 s moral nature. (p. 3 of williams , 260 of bjornlie show different translations of same passage in relation this).


god in things natural (is intramundane ), seneca:



quisquis formator universi fuit sive ille deus est portens omnium, sive incorporalis ratio, ingentium operum artifex, sive divinus spiritus, per omnia, maxima, minima, aequali intentione diffusus



to achieve existence in keeping correct manner of living (that being ethical) depended on person fulfilling existence in accordance principles of ius naturae (p. 258 ), of divine universal order lex universi (seneca - ep 76.23 shown @ p. 84-5 ), inherent in totum of nature. make 1 in agreement nature (όμολογουμένως τή φύσει).


stoics in history considered telos (goal) of efforts kata physin (according nature). participation of faculty of reason within divine order stems in part platonic thought.
